What Are BLDC Fans?

BLDC fans are a modern innovation in ceiling fan technology. Unlike traditional fans that use brushed motors, BLDC fans operate using brushless motors, which rely on electronic controllers to manage the fan’s speed and performance. This technology eliminates the need for brushes, reducing friction and energy loss, resulting in a more efficient and quieter operation.

Why Consider BLDC Fans for Commercial Spaces?

Commercial spaces have unique requirements when it comes to ventilation and cooling. High foot traffic, extended operating hours, and the need for cost-effective solutions make BLDC fans an attractive option. Here’s why:

1. Energy Efficiency

BLDC fans consume significantly less electricity compared to conventional fans. On average, they use up to 65% less energy, which translates to substantial savings on electricity bills. For commercial spaces that run fans for long hours, this efficiency can lead to a noticeable reduction in operational costs.

2. Cost Savings in the Long Run

While BLDC fans may have a higher upfront cost, their energy-saving capabilities ensure a quick return on investment. Over time, the savings on electricity bills can offset the initial expense, making them a cost-effective choice for businesses.

3. Durability and Low Maintenance

BLDC fans are designed to last longer than traditional fans. The absence of brushes reduces wear and tear, resulting in fewer breakdowns and lower maintenance costs. This is particularly beneficial for commercial spaces where frequent repairs can disrupt operations.

4. Quiet Operation

Noise levels are a critical factor in commercial environments like offices, libraries, and restaurants. BLDC fans operate quietly, ensuring a comfortable and distraction-free atmosphere for customers and employees.

5. Environmentally Friendly

With a growing emphasis on sustainability, BLDC fans are an eco-friendly choice. Their reduced energy consumption helps lower carbon footprints, aligning with green building standards and corporate sustainability goals.

Key Features to Look for in BLDC Fans for Commercial Use

When selecting BLDC fans for your commercial space, consider the following features to maximize their benefits:

  • High Air Delivery: Ensure the fan provides adequate airflow to cover large areas.
  • Speed Settings: Look for fans with multiple speed options for better control.
  • Remote Control or Smart Features: Modern BLDC fans often come with remote controls or smart connectivity for added convenience.
  • Design and Aesthetics: Choose fans that complement the interior design of your commercial space.
  • Warranty and After-Sales Service: Opt for brands that offer reliable warranties and customer support.
